How to Draw Your Weapon
Switch Weapons Quickly with the D-Pad
If you're playing on PlayStation or Xbox, press left on the d-pad and then press X (or A on Xbox) to equip the weapon currently shown to the left of your health bar. This lets you quickly pull out the weapon you're ready to use.
Alternatively, hold left on the d-pad to cycle through your weapon slots, which can help avoid accidentally pulling out the wrong one (trust me, we’ve all been there).
Cycle Through Weapons
If you want to pull out a different weapon, just press left on the d-pad multiple times:
First press: Pulls out the weapon on the left of your health bar.
Second press: Switches to the next weapon.
Third press: You get the idea—keep pressing left to cycle through all your equipped weapons.
Using Bluetooth vs. USB
If the controls don’t seem to work, there may be a bug. Some have reported that using a USB-connected controller might cause issues, but switching to Bluetooth can solve the problem. So if it’s not working for you, try switching how you connect your controller.
Tip for a Smooth Switch
Holding left on the d-pad to cycle through weapons works better for many players since it reduces the chances of accidentally pulling out the wrong weapon. Give that a try if you're struggling with the default method!
